Why Use Counted Cross Stitch Patterns?
Counted cross stitch patterns make it easy to follow a design by using a grid system. Each square on the grid represents a stitch, allowing you to create intricate and detailed designs with ease. Additionally, cross stitch is a versatile technique that can be used on a variety of fabrics, from traditional Aida cloth to evenweaves and linens.
When it comes to Christmas stockings, counted cross stitch patterns can help you create unique designs that reflect your family's personality and interests. You can add names, dates, and special messages to make each stocking truly one-of-a-kind.

Materials
The most essential materials you'll need for counted cross stitch are a needle, thread, and fabric. For beginners, it's recommended to use Aida cloth, which is a stiff fabric that makes it easy to keep your stitches even and straight.

Tips
Here are a few tips to keep in mind when working on your counted cross stitch project:
- Always use good lighting to prevent eye strain and ensure accuracy.
- Avoid pulling your stitches too tightly, as this can cause the fabric to pucker.
- Use a hoop or frame to keep your fabric taut and prevent wrinkles.
